FreeStyle Libre 3 Review & Specs

Abbott's tiny sensor that streams real-time data continuously without needing to scan.

The FreeStyle Libre 3 marks a major shift for Abbott's CGM line. Unlike the Libre 1 and 2, which required the user to physically scan the sensor with a phone to get a reading (Flash Glucose Monitoring), the Libre 3 is a true Continuous Glucose Monitor that streams data via Bluetooth continuously.

Form Factor & Wearability

The Libre 3 is currently the smallest and thinnest CGM available. It is roughly the size of two stacked pennies. This ultra-low profile significantly reduces the chances of the sensor getting caught on clothing and being pulled off prematurely.

Accuracy & Clinical Data

In clinical trials involving adults, the FreeStyle Libre 3 achieved an overall MARD (Mean Absolute Relative Difference) of 7.9%. This is highly accurate and comparable to (or slightly better than) its main competitor, the Dexcom G7.

Specification Detail
Wear Time 14 Days (Longest wear time for non-implantable CGM)
Warmup Time 60 Minutes
Approved Insertion Sites Back of upper arm only
Pump Integration (AID) Tandem Mobi, t:slim X2 (Requires Libre 2 Plus sensor in US)

Limitations

While the hardware is exceptional, the Libre 3 has a few limitations compared to Dexcom:

  • No Calibration: You cannot calibrate the Libre 3 with a fingerstick if it is reading inaccurately.
  • App Constraints: The Libre 3 app is often criticized for being less intuitive and having fewer alarm customization options than Dexcom.
  • No Grace Period: When the 14-day session ends, it ends abruptly without a grace period.
